Miraggio is a crewneck necklace in pure cotton where the ancient crochet work takes over the scene: a riot of stitches wraps the base of can tabs embellishing any simple garment.
Try to turn the necklace wearing the button on the front: surprising how your jewel will turn into a bon-ton style collar!

In addition, the nature of the materials and coloring techniques, allow the necklace to be washed in water without contraindications.

The wasted recovered materials are the tabs of aluminum cans: after a thorough cleaning, they are crocheted with a pure cotton yarn.

In addition, the buttons closing the necklaces are always unique because they are vintage pieces meticulously selected.
The small black medal that bears the logo is finally recovered by laser cutting old vinyls.
'Peekaboo!' is a Made in Italy collection of handcrafted sustainable jewelry made with wasted aluminum can tabs. The regeneration involves an innovative powder coating process and successive crochet work. The ancient tradition of this process meets the innovation of materials and color.
